Martyrs of the French Revolution – September 2nd.

Practically every page in the history of the French Revolution is stained with blood. What is known in history as the Carmelite Massacre if 1792, added nearly 200 victims to this noble company of martyrs. They were all priests, nuns, secular and religious, … Continue reading
